当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

数据库服务器配置参数有哪些,深入解析数据库服务器配置参数,优化性能与稳定性之道

数据库服务器配置参数有哪些,深入解析数据库服务器配置参数,优化性能与稳定性之道

数据库服务器配置参数包括连接数、缓存大小、锁机制等,本文深入解析这些参数,探讨如何优化数据库性能与稳定性。通过合理配置,提高数据库处理能力,降低故障风险。...

数据库服务器配置参数包括连接数、缓存大小、锁机制等,本文深入解析这些参数,探讨如何优化数据库性能与稳定性。通过合理配置,提高数据库处理能力,降低故障风险。

数据库作为现代信息系统中不可或缺的核心组件,其性能与稳定性直接影响着整个系统的运行效率,数据库服务器的配置参数是影响数据库性能的关键因素之一,本文将详细介绍数据库服务器配置参数的设置方法,帮助您优化数据库性能与稳定性。

数据库服务器配置参数概述

数据库服务器配置参数主要包括以下几个方面:

1、内存配置

数据库服务器配置参数有哪些,深入解析数据库服务器配置参数,优化性能与稳定性之道

2、硬件配置

3、网络配置

4、存储配置

5、安全配置

6、日志配置

7、事务配置

8、集群配置

内存配置

1、数据库缓存(Database Cache):合理设置数据库缓存大小,可以显著提高数据库查询性能,数据库缓存包括数据缓存和索引缓存,数据缓存占内存的比例应大于索引缓存。

2、临时缓存(Temp Cache):用于存储数据库操作过程中产生的临时数据,如排序、分组等,适当增加临时缓存大小,可以提高数据库的查询性能。

3、线程缓存(Thread Cache):用于存储数据库连接信息,减少数据库连接开销,合理设置线程缓存大小,可以提高数据库并发处理能力。

硬件配置

1、CPU:根据数据库服务器的工作负载,选择合适的CPU型号和核心数,多核CPU可以提高数据库并发处理能力。

数据库服务器配置参数有哪些,深入解析数据库服务器配置参数,优化性能与稳定性之道

2、内存:合理配置内存大小,确保数据库缓存、临时缓存和线程缓存有足够的空间。

3、硬盘:选择高速、大容量的硬盘,如SSD,SSD具有较低的延迟和较高的读写速度,有利于提高数据库性能。

网络配置

1、网络带宽:确保数据库服务器与客户端之间的网络带宽足够,以满足数据传输需求。

2、网络延迟:降低网络延迟,提高数据库响应速度。

3、网络协议:根据实际需求,选择合适的网络协议,如TCP/IP、UDP等。

存储配置

1、数据文件:合理配置数据文件大小,避免数据文件频繁扩展。

2、索引文件:合理配置索引文件大小,确保索引文件在磁盘上有足够的空间。

3、线程数:根据数据库并发需求,设置合适的线程数,提高数据库并发处理能力。

安全配置

1、数据库用户权限:合理分配数据库用户权限,确保数据安全。

2、加密:对敏感数据进行加密,防止数据泄露。

3、审计:开启数据库审计功能,记录数据库操作日志,便于追踪和监控。

数据库服务器配置参数有哪些,深入解析数据库服务器配置参数,优化性能与稳定性之道

日志配置

1、错误日志:记录数据库错误信息,便于问题排查。

2、性能日志:记录数据库性能数据,便于性能分析和优化。

3、安全日志:记录数据库安全事件,便于安全监控。

事务配置

1、事务隔离级别:根据业务需求,设置合适的事务隔离级别,平衡性能与数据一致性。

2、事务日志:合理配置事务日志大小,确保事务日志有足够的空间。

3、事务提交:合理设置事务提交间隔,提高数据库并发处理能力。

集群配置

1、负载均衡:合理配置负载均衡策略,确保数据库集群中的资源得到充分利用。

2、高可用:通过冗余配置,提高数据库集群的可用性。

3、自动故障转移:当数据库节点发生故障时,自动将请求切换到其他正常节点。

数据库服务器配置参数的设置对数据库性能与稳定性至关重要,通过合理配置内存、硬件、网络、存储、安全、日志、事务和集群等方面的参数,可以显著提高数据库性能,降低故障风险,在实际应用中,应根据具体业务需求和系统环境,不断优化数据库服务器配置参数,确保数据库系统稳定、高效地运行。

黑狐家游戏

发表评论

最新文章